#656373 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#656373 is composed of 39.6% red, 38.8% green and 45.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.2% cyan, 13.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 54.9% black. It has a hue angle of 247.5 degrees, a saturation of 7.5% and a lightness of 42%. #656373 color hex could be obtained by blending #cac6e6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

Shades and Tints of #656373
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#08080a is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.
